Gold Mountain Mine

Standing near the main portal, you can see the remains of an old ore bin circa 1947 and the last attempt to work this mine. A 40 stamp mill built in 1900 that replaced an even earlier 1875 eight stamp mill, would have been to the right of my truck all that's left are the massive concrete foundations that once supported the stamps.
The valley right below was the site of the town of Doble and in the distance you can see Baldwin Lake "now dry" and all the "new development" on the east shore. I love this view !
